Output 8736a7f693f50c63e23c22f5d327df164294ecdbb6722dcf3fc47ef8a72b630a:9

value
433333
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b10d3ca0e97482514080b5eb89160e8ee9c25296 OP_EQUAL
address
3HqBPD4mNPe4Fmx2iqREy6f1fGHNzXE7NZ
transaction
8736a7f693f50c63e23c22f5d327df164294ecdbb6722dcf3fc47ef8a72b630a
confirmations
221380
spent
true